So 2 days ago my speedometer decided to say I was going 170mph when I was actually going like 60. It has always been slightly ahead too. I read through some old posts about similar issues, but no one had a clear answer.

Thoughts?
 
The only time I had my speedo going crazy was when my alternator wasn't working at all and all the electrical systems were running off the battery and draining it. At one point from jumping like crazy, the speedo needle just went to 0 and shortly after I lost all power.

So all I can suggest is checking your alternator and the wires from it, if it's charging properly etc. After that I would give your speed sensor on the trans a visual check. A friend of mine once had a similar issue, actually. He had a 420a Eclipse and had to change trans, so he swapped it with a trans from a PT Cruiser but the speed sensor was different so it was reading really high speeds because the ratios were off. But if you haven't swapped trans or sensor that shouldn't be your case.
